Allianz Asset Management GmbH Decreases Position in NetApp, Inc. (NASDAQ:NTAP)

Allianz Asset Management GmbH decreased its holdings in shares of NetApp, Inc. (NASDAQ:NTAPFree Report) by 1.8% in the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The fund owned 1,804,030 shares of the data storage provider’s stock after selling 33,820 shares during the quarter. Allianz Asset Management GmbH’s holdings in NetApp were worth $209,412,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

NetApp Stock Up 0.0 %

NetApp stock opened at $124.55 on Friday.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.39, a current ratio of 0.91 and a quick ratio of 0.84. NetApp, Inc. has a 1-year low of $83.80 and a 1-year high of $135.45. The company has a market cap of $25.32 billion, a PE ratio of 22.90,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 2.96 and a beta of 1.23. The stock’s 50 day moving average price is $120.05 and its 200 day moving average price is $121.84.

NetApp (NASDAQ:NTAPG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, November 21st. The data storage provider reported $1.87 earnings per share for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$1.78 by $0.09. The firm had revenue of $1.66 billion for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$1.65 billion. NetApp had a return on equity of 123.63% and a net margin of 17.78%. The company’s revenue for the quarter was up 6.1%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period in the previous year, the business earned $1.23 earnings per share. On average, sell-side analysts predict that NetApp, Inc. will post 5.89 EPS for the current fiscal year.

NetApp Company Profile

(Free Report)

NetApp, Inc provides cloud-led and data-centric services to manage and share data on-premises, and private and public clouds worldwide. It operates in two segments, Hybrid Cloud and Public Could. The company offers intelligent data management software, such as NetApp ONTAP, NetApp Snapshot, NetApp SnapCenter Backup Management, NetApp SnapMirror Data Replication, NetApp SnapLock Data Compliance, and storage infrastructure solutions, including NetApp All-Flash FAS series, NetApp Fabric Attached Storage, NetApp E/EF series, and NetApp StorageGRID.
